On Mon, Dec 7, 2015 at 11:37 PM, Fujii Masao <masao.fujii@gmail.com> wrote:
The latest patch has another problem; pg_receivexlog trying to connect to
the PostgreSQL >= 9.4 always reports the following message unexpectedly.

could not identify system: got 1 rows and 4 fields, expected 1 rows
and 4 or more fields

This problem happens because the patch incorrectly treats the case where
IDENTIFY_SYSTEM command returns NULL as database name, as an error case.

Attached is the updated version of the patch, which fixes the problem.
Comments?

The patch looks good. The top comment of RunIdentifySystem is incorrect though. It should mention that a database name is returned and not a plugin name.
